Blind Nurserock band performing tonight at Concerts in the Park
Comments on Stories, posted by Editor, Pleasanton Weekly Online, on Jul 20, 2012 at 8:24 am

Bring family, friends, and a blanket to tonight's concert in the park from 7-8:30 p.m. at Lions Wayside Park at the corner of First and Neal streets. Tonight's concert will feature modern and classic rock by Blind Nurse. For more information visit www.pleasantondowntown.net.
